- Title
Necessary and sufficient conditions for oscillation of nonlinear first-order forced differential equations with several delays of neutral type.
- Authors
Pinelas, Sandra; Santra, Shyam S.
- Abstract
In this work, necessary and sufficient conditions are obtained such that every solution of nonlinear neutral first-order differential equations with several delays of the form (x (t) + r (t) x (t - τ) ) ′ + ∑ i = 1 m ϕ i (t) H (x (t - σ i)) = f (t) \bigl{(}x(t)+r(t)x(t-\tau)\bigr{)}^{\prime}+\sum_{i=1}^{m}\phi_{i}(t)H\bigl{(}% x(t-\sigma_{i})\bigr{)}=f(t) is oscillatory or tends to zero as t → ∞. {t\rightarrow\infty.} This problem is considered in various ranges of the neutral coefficient r. Finally, some illustrating examples are presented to show that feasibility and effectiveness of main results.
